Bayard Rustin was a powerful leader in the fight for civil rights and social justice. He worked closely with Dr. Martin Luther King Jr. and helped organize the famous March on Washington in 1963. Rustin’s ideas and words inspired many people to stand up for equality and fairness. His quotes offer deep insights into love, justice, and activism that still resonate today.
